Deebo Samuel fantasy football start 'em, sit 'em picks for Week 5 (2024). Should you start or sit Deebo Samuel for fantasy football lineups?
BALLER MOVE: Must-Start
POSITIONAL VALUE: WR2 with WR1 Upside
ANALYSIS: If you sit someone like San Francisco 49ers wide receiver Deebo Samuel Sr., you deserve to see him make plays like this. He's electric.

Samuel has a skillset that few other receivers have. Maybe none in today's NFL. He's almost a completely unique player. A receiver that can win consistently on routes and be used like a running back, and consistently puts up monster YAC numbers, on one of the best offenses in the NFL yearly.
There is no justifiable reason to bench Samuel. He's incredible.

He's ridiculously good. And he's going against the Arizona Cardinals this week, who just got blown out by the Washington Commanders. This has a chance of being a massive game for Samuel. Do not leave him on your bench. Start him with the utmost confidence.
